If you go back to 35 or so, you'll find many of failed turbos were made by a company that used a custom compressor. They didn't use the Mitsubishi compressor.

The Blouch 19T turbos have a good reputation. So did the Deadbolt ones when he was still making them.

If you have a good pnp job done that hogs out the snail in the right places and then pop on an external gate you could maybe get close to 300WHP. Otherwise just a dream for anything to get close to 300WHP with a 6 cm housing and internal gate. Even small 16G's and 7 cm housings don't get to 300WHP on 2 liter motors.

Anyone who claims 300WHP with a 19T I want to see some data with MAF logs etc. Show me a 19T pulling 4.6V+ with an internal gate on a 2 liter, just one. Best I've seen so far is 4.4 posted. Getting tired of the BS really, this is not a 300WHP turbo not even close in a normal setup...

Dyno and airflow... I would be expecting something over 4.7 MAFV V on the stock MAF for that power level. My old setup ran more than that with a fully built 2.1 stroker PnP heads, STI cams and EWG on the small 16G. Internal gate, stock motor I don't see how it gets there
